Marriage

The strict dictionary definition of marriage is "to unite, to become one". A person will find a life-long companion to experience laughs and cries with. This joyous custom is rich with happiness and fulfillment because it is based on love. Commitment, friendship and experience are qualities that make marriage a unique custom. Two people living the love they promise are committed to each other. In marriage a person appreciates that their partner will give all their endurance to show loyalty. Giving your mate a simple kiss for no specific reason or taking your wife to a five- star restaurant can scream commitment. This custom allows a person to give and receive.
